NORCO, Calif. (Dec. 7, 2011) Navy veteran and Pearl Harbor survivor John Busma, age 94, right, a Machinist's Mate 1st Class aboard the repair ship USS Medusa (AR 1) on December 7, 1941, salutes during singing of "Amazing Grace" during fifth annual Pearl Harbor Commemorative Celebration at Naval Weapons Station Seal Beach (NWSSB), Detachment Norco, home of Naval Surface Warfare Center (NSWC), Corona Division. Themed "Keeping Traditions Alive," the event marked the 70th anniversary of the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or and 70 years of Navy presence in Riverside County, first as a naval hospital serving wounded from Pearl Harbor and currently as the Navy's independent assessment agent and one of its newest federal labs.
